How Much Does it Cost to Attend a Robotics Conference?

Taking part in a robotics conference can provide valuable insights into the most recent developments in the field of robotics. However, the price of participation varies and usually ranges from $500 to $1000. This variation is due to several factors, each of which contributes to the overall expense.

Here are some factors that influence the cost:

Location

The venue of the conference significantly impacts the cost. Events held in major cities or popular destinations tend to be more expensive due to higher venue rental and living costs. Additionally, your travel and accommodation expenses will be influenced by the location, potentially adding to the total cost.

Duration

The length of the conference affects the cost as well. Longer events require more days of accommodation and meals, increasing the overall expense. However, extended conferences often offer more sessions and networking opportunities, providing greater value.

Registration Cost

The registration cost for robotics conferences varies depending on the event’s scale, location, and offerings. This fee typically covers access to presentations, workshops, and networking opportunities, making it a crucial factor in your overall budget.

Amenities

The amenities included in your conference ticket also affect the price. Some conferences provide meals, workshop materials, and access to special sessions, which can enhance your experience but also increase the cost. You should consider what’s included in the ticket price when budgeting for the event.

Early Bird Discounts

Many conferences offer discounted rates for early registration. By registering early, you can significantly reduce your expenses. It’s a good idea to plan ahead and take advantage of these early bird discounts to save money.

Student Rates

Students often qualify for reduced conference rates. This can make attending more affordable for those currently enrolled in educational institutions. Check if the conference you’re interested in offers student discounts to lower your costs.

Sponsorship and Grants

Some organizations and institutions provide funding or grants for conference attendance. This financial support can cover part or all of your expenses, making it easier to attend. If you’re presenting your work or affiliated with a research institution, explore these funding opportunities.

Is There a Difference in Cost Between Virtual and In-person Attendance?

Yes, the cost of attending a virtual robotics conference is often lower than attending in person. Virtual attendance typically eliminates the need for travel, accommodation, and meals, making it a more affordable option. However, in-person conferences often provide richer networking experiences and hands-on access to technologies through exhibits and workshops.

Are There Any Hidden Costs I Should Be Aware of When Attending a Robotics Conference?

You should consider additional costs such as parking fees, tickets for special networking events, or expenses related to optional activities and workshops that are not included in the standard registration fee. These can add up, so it’s a good idea to review the full event schedule and pricing details to avoid surprises.

Can I Attend only Specific Sessions or Days of The Conference, and Will This Affect the Cost?

Yes, many conferences offer day passes or session-specific tickets at a reduced cost compared to full conference registration. However, access to certain activities, networking opportunities, or workshops may be limited depending on the pass you purchase. It’s a good way to save money if you’re only interested in specific sessions.
